1、JavaScript訪問(wèn)CSS屬性的方式總體說(shuō)來(lái)有兩種:“通過(guò)元素訪問(wèn)”、“直接訪問(wèn)樣式表”。另外訪問(wèn)樣式的時(shí)候有一個(gè)不可忽略的問(wèn)題——運(yùn)行時(shí)樣式。通過(guò)元素訪問(wèn)既然是要通過(guò)元素訪問(wèn)樣式表,那么就應(yīng)該先確定是哪個(gè)元素。
創(chuàng)新互聯(lián)公司一直通過(guò)網(wǎng)站建設(shè)和網(wǎng)站營(yíng)銷幫助企業(yè)獲得更多客戶資源。 以"深度挖掘,量身打造,注重實(shí)效"的一站式服務(wù),以成都網(wǎng)站設(shè)計(jì)、成都做網(wǎng)站、移動(dòng)互聯(lián)產(chǎn)品、全網(wǎng)整合營(yíng)銷推廣服務(wù)為核心業(yè)務(wù)。10余年網(wǎng)站制作的經(jīng)驗(yàn),使用新網(wǎng)站建設(shè)技術(shù),全新開(kāi)發(fā)出的標(biāo)準(zhǔn)網(wǎng)站,不但價(jià)格便宜而且實(shí)用、靈活,特別適合中小公司網(wǎng)站制作。網(wǎng)站管理系統(tǒng)簡(jiǎn)單易用,維護(hù)方便,您可以完全操作網(wǎng)站資料,是中小公司快速網(wǎng)站建設(shè)的選擇。
2、鏈接式即為用link標(biāo)簽引入css文件,例如 導(dǎo)入式即為用import引入css文件,例如@import url(test.css)如果想用javascript獲取一個(gè)元素的樣式信息,首先想到的應(yīng)該是元素的style屬性。
3、當(dāng)然你可以用更多的樣式表,隨后在載入時(shí)進(jìn)行隨機(jī)替換,因?yàn)樽钕容d入的default.css樣式是直接寫(xiě)在頁(yè)面上,而JS隨機(jī)載入的后面CSS文件會(huì)覆蓋之前的CSS,只要CSS中的元素名稱相同即可。
4、首先在電腦中打開(kāi)一個(gè)需要獲取CSS數(shù)據(jù)的網(wǎng)頁(yè)。在網(wǎng)頁(yè)的空白處點(diǎn)擊鼠標(biāo)右鍵,選擇“審查元素”的選項(xiàng)。點(diǎn)擊后在頁(yè)面的下方會(huì)打開(kāi)一個(gè)網(wǎng)頁(yè)元素代碼窗口。
5、JavaScript如何動(dòng)態(tài)更改CSS頁(yè)面樣式?如果要在JavaScript中更改頁(yè)面樣式,需要更改元素的樣式屬性,下面我們就來(lái)看看具體的實(shí)現(xiàn)內(nèi)容。
當(dāng)然可以,比如:document.querySelector(#font_set).style.color = red你的代碼中出現(xiàn)明顯的錯(cuò)誤,兩個(gè)標(biāo)簽的 id 設(shè)置相同的 font_set。建議找個(gè)教程系統(tǒng)學(xué)習(xí),你的這種寫(xiě)法:color=getColor(1) 沒(méi)有任何根據(jù)。
對(duì)于使用短劃線的CSS屬性名,必須將其轉(zhuǎn)換成駝峰大小寫(xiě)形式。
方法步驟:先獲取要改變css的元素。改變這個(gè)元素的style屬性。eg:下面是改變div的背景色,改為藍(lán)色。
alert(document.getElementById(css88).style.color);//空白 /script /body /html 上面這個(gè)例子對(duì)id為css88的div設(shè)置了2種煩事的樣式,包括style和外部樣式class。
我們?cè)贖TML中經(jīng)常需要引入CSS和JS文件,那么如何引入呢?下面我給大家演示一下。
js是無(wú)法直接修改css文件的,但可以通過(guò)取對(duì)象的方式修改對(duì)象的樣式,通常有兩種方法:改變className,但首先在樣式表中預(yù)設(shè)定樣式類。例如:document.getElementById(obj).className=...改變cssText。
1、當(dāng)然你可以用更多的樣式表,隨后在載入時(shí)進(jìn)行隨機(jī)替換,因?yàn)樽钕容d入的default.css樣式是直接寫(xiě)在頁(yè)面上,而JS隨機(jī)載入的后面CSS文件會(huì)覆蓋之前的CSS,只要CSS中的元素名稱相同即可。
2、js是無(wú)法直接修改css文件的,但可以通過(guò)取對(duì)象的方式修改對(duì)象的樣式,通常有兩種方法:\x0d\x0a改變className,但首先在樣式表中預(yù)設(shè)定樣式類。
3、Javascript獲取頁(yè)面的元素的樣式常見(jiàn)的兩個(gè)方法是 document.getElementById(), document.querySelector();方法。2 在下面的實(shí)例中是使用Javascript來(lái)改變標(biāo)簽的背景顏色,使用的是document.querySelector()方法。
4、在c.css里寫(xiě)好你的樣式:.cssStyle {你的樣式};然后在a.js里加入$(span).addClass(cssStyle)即可。
5、js部分可以用:obj.className = aa 這樣就可以將aa的樣式加到div上了。寫(xiě)css樣式的時(shí)候需要注意的是,由于id的優(yōu)先級(jí)高, 所以如果想在class里覆蓋id里的樣式,需要給#divaa寫(xiě)樣式。
6、height: 200px;background-color: red;} divaa { border-radius: 50%;background-color: #000;} js部分可以用:obj.className = aa 這樣就可以將aa的樣式加到div上了。
1、Web前端開(kāi)發(fā)環(huán)境,HTML常用標(biāo)簽,表單元素,Table布局,CSS樣式表,DIV+CSS布局。熟練運(yùn)用HTML和CSS樣式屬性完成頁(yè)面的布局和美化,能夠仿制任意網(wǎng)站的前端頁(yè)面實(shí)現(xiàn)。
2、初級(jí)前端工程師:首先要知道的就是如何處理各種瀏覽器的兼容處理(比如說(shuō)在IE瀏覽器中的createElement有什么不同等等內(nèi)容),現(xiàn)在基本上每個(gè)公司在招聘的時(shí)候都會(huì)要求熟練html5,css3,javascript,這個(gè)熟練的意思就是信手拈來(lái)。
3、前端學(xué)習(xí)路線圖:第一階段:HTML+CSS:HTML進(jìn)階、CSS進(jìn)階、div+css布局、HTML+css整站開(kāi)發(fā)、JavaScript基礎(chǔ):Js基礎(chǔ)教程、js內(nèi)置對(duì)象常用方法、常見(jiàn)DOM樹(shù)操作大全、ECMAscript、DOM、BOM、定時(shí)器和焦點(diǎn)圖。
4、想要成為一個(gè)好的前端程序員,需要掌握的技術(shù)還是比較多的,比如HTML5開(kāi)發(fā)、JavaScript、Veu.js框架開(kāi)發(fā)等等。前端就是展現(xiàn)給用戶瀏覽的部分。
5、HTML5+CSS3是HTML+CSS的更新,增加了很多非常實(shí)用的功能。這部分主要是從PC端和移動(dòng)端兩方面掌握整體的頁(yè)面布局技術(shù),并且配合項(xiàng)目實(shí)戰(zhàn)操練、學(xué)以致用。
隨機(jī)載入CSS樣式的JS效果實(shí)際上很好實(shí)現(xiàn),本文的代碼如下,具體思路是用一個(gè)默認(rèn)的CSS樣式:default.css。另外再用三個(gè)其他名稱的CSS:skincss,skincss,skincss。
Javascript獲取頁(yè)面的元素的樣式常見(jiàn)的兩個(gè)方法是 document.getElementById(), document.querySelector();方法。2 在下面的實(shí)例中是使用Javascript來(lái)改變標(biāo)簽的背景顏色,使用的是document.querySelector()方法。
在c.css里寫(xiě)好你的樣式:.cssStyle {你的樣式};然后在a.js里加入$(span).addClass(cssStyle)即可。
js是無(wú)法直接修改css文件的,但可以通過(guò)取對(duì)象的方式修改對(duì)象的樣式,通常有兩種方法:改變className,但首先在樣式表中預(yù)設(shè)定樣式類。例如:document.getElementById(obj).className=...改變cssText。
本文一開(kāi)始就說(shuō)明了,因?yàn)镮E各版本的瀏覽器對(duì)我們制作的WEB標(biāo)準(zhǔn)的頁(yè)面解釋不一樣,具體就是對(duì)CSS的解釋不同,我們?yōu)榱思嫒葸@些,可運(yùn)用條件注釋來(lái)各自定義,最終達(dá)到兼容的目的。
導(dǎo)入式即為用import引入css文件,例如@import url(test.css)如果想用javascript獲取一個(gè)元素的樣式信息,首先想到的應(yīng)該是元素的style屬性。
我們想要獲得css 的樣式, box.style.left 和 box.style.backgorundColor 但是它只能得到 行內(nèi)的樣式。 但是我們工作最多用的是 內(nèi)嵌式 或者 外鏈?zhǔn)?。
隨機(jī)載入CSS樣式的JS效果實(shí)際上很好實(shí)現(xiàn),本文的代碼如下,具體思路是用一個(gè)默認(rèn)的CSS樣式:default.css。另外再用三個(gè)其他名稱的CSS:skincss,skincss,skincss。
后面的“$”匹配輸入字符串的結(jié)尾位置。 倒數(shù)第二個(gè)“?”匹配前面的子表達(dá)式0次或1次,即最多匹配1次。 第一個(gè)括號(hào)內(nèi)匹配“l(fā)ogin”或“register”或“.js”或“.img”或“.css”。
//上面的樣式,修改了一下,加了一個(gè)class和設(shè)置了一個(gè)背景圖。
首先在電腦中打開(kāi)一個(gè)需要獲取CSS數(shù)據(jù)的網(wǎng)頁(yè)。在網(wǎng)頁(yè)的空白處點(diǎn)擊鼠標(biāo)右鍵,選擇“審查元素”的選項(xiàng)。點(diǎn)擊后在頁(yè)面的下方會(huì)打開(kāi)一個(gè)網(wǎng)頁(yè)元素代碼窗口。